Effect Of Additives On The Quality Of Juncao Ganoderma Fungus Chaff And Fermentation Process

This study respectively took the ganoderma fungus chaff as raw materials for the fermentation.Use three additives (fermented green juice FGJ,cellulase, xylanase) on different five experiments.Effect of cellulase addition levels on the quality of fermented ganoderma fungus chaff feed and fermentation process;Effect of xylanase addition levels on the quality of fermented ganoderma fungus chaff feed and fermentation process;Effect of FGJ and different cellulase addition levels on the quality of fermented ganoderma fungus chaff feed and fermentation process;Effect of FGJ and different xylanase addition levels on the quality of fermented ganoderma fungus chaff feed and fermentation process;Effect on the Quality of Fermented Ganodorma Fungus Chaff Feed Supplied by Fermented Green Juice,Cellulase and xylanase,in order to provided a theoretical basis for the large-scale production of high quality of fermented feed.There were a control group.In experiment l,the fungus chaff were treated with cellulase (CEL) at the rates of 500 U/kg(CEL1),1000 U/kg (CEL2) and 2000 U/kg (CEL3).In experiment 2,the fungus chaff were treated with xylanase (XYL) at the rates of 1250 U/kg(XYL1),2500 U/kg (XYL2) and 5000 U/kg (XYL3).In experiment 3,the fungus chaff were treated with (FGJ+CEL,MIX) at the rates of 2 ml/kg FGJ+500 U/kg CEL(MIX1),2 ml/kg FGJ+1000 U/kg CEL(MIX2),2 ml/kg FGJ+2000 U/kg CEL(MDC3).In experiment 4, the fungus chaff were treated with (FGJ+XYL,MIX) at the rates of 2 ml/kg FGJ+1250U/kg XYL (MIX1),2 ml/kg FGJ+2500U/kg XYL(MIX2),2 ml/kg FGJ+5000 U/kg XYL(MIX3).In experiment 5,the fungus chaff were treated with 2ml/kg FGJ,2000U/kg CEL,5000U/kg XYL,2ml/kg FGJ+2000U/kg CEL (MIX1),2ml/kg FGJ+5000U/kg XYL (MIX2),2ml/kg FGJ+2000U/kg CEL+5000U/kg XYL(MIX3).Each treatment was repeated 3 times,the materials were ensiled at room temperature and opened after 7d,14d,30d,60d,to determine its feed fermentation quality and chemical composition.Experiment 1:The effect of three cellulose addition levels were significantly improved on four fermentation days.The best adding effect of fermented 7d is CEL2 group,the CEL2 and CEL3 groups are similar in fermented 30d,they are better than CELlgroup.The best adding effect of fermented 14d and 30d is CEL3 group. With the increase of fermentation days,the lactic acid (LA) show a trend of increasing,the pH and DMR were declining,GLR increased(P< 0.05).the WSC,NDF and HC started declining,AN increased(P<0.05).Add a certain level of cellulase,the fermentation process is ended prematurely.Experiment 2:The three levels of added xylanase were significantly improved on the fouth fermentation days.The best added effect of fermented 7d and 14d is XYL1 group,the three XYL groups are similar in fermented 30d and 60d. With the increase of fermentation’s days,the LA show a trend of increasing,the pH and DMR were declining,GLR was increased(P<0.05).the WSC,NDF and HC were declining,AN show a trend of increasing.By adding a certain level of xylanase,the fermentation process is ended prematurely.Experiment 3:The effect of three MIX groups were significantly improved on four fermentation’s days.The best adding effect of fermented 7d is MIX2 group.the three MIX groups are similar in fermented 14d,30d and 60d. With the increasing of fermentation’s days,the LA show a trend of increasing,the pH,WSC,NDF and HC were declining,GLR,AN increased(P<0.05).The fermentation process is ended prematurely when FGJ and cellulase were added at the same time.Experiment 4:The effect of three MIX groups were significantly improved on four fermentation’s days.The best of adding effect are MIX3 groups when open on 7d,14d,30d,60d.With the increase of fermentation’s days,the LA show a trend of increasing,the pH,DMR,WSC,NDF and HC were declining, GLR,AN increased(P<0.05).FGJ and xylanase were added to speed up the lactic acid fermentation, the fermentation process is ended prematurely.Experiment 5:The results showed that compared with the CON group,the WSC of other groups was significantly increase (P<0.01), the pH,GLR,NDF,HC and AN had highly significant reduced (P<0.01). Compared with the FGJ group, the LA of the MIX1and MIX2 group were respectively reduced and highly significant increased (P<0.05,.P<0.01),the WSC of other groups was significantly increased (P<0.01), the AN was significantly reduced (P<0.01).Compared with the CEL groups, the NDF of the MIX1 group were significantly reduced (P<0.01),the WSC was significantly increased(P<0.01).Compared with the MIX1 and MIX2 group,,the pH,GLR of the MIX3 group were significantly reduced (P<0.01), the ADF reduced (P<0.05). In a word,the effect of adding cellulose and adding xylanase were better than the effect of adding fermented green juice,and the effect of mixed group were better than just one,especially the best of adding effect is MIX3.
